Join Our Team as a Speech Therapist I at UNC Hospitals Rehabilitation Services

UNC Hospitals Rehabilitation Services is seeking a compassionate and dedicated Speech Therapist I to join our multidisciplinary team at the Center for Rehab Care in Chapel Hill, NC. This full-time position (40 hours per week) offers an exciting opportunity to provide high-quality care to adult patients with neurological conditions in an outpatient setting.

Location & Travel: This position is primarily based at our Meadowmont Neurology and Center for Rehab Care locations. Some travel between clinics will be required, offering a dynamic and varied work experience.

As a Speech Therapist I, you'll provide comprehensive speech and language therapy for individuals with neurological conditions, helping patients regain functional communication, cognition, and swallowing abilities. You’ll have the chance to collaborate with an interdisciplinary team and participate in specialized clinical programs. Your role will also involve working directly with patients, scheduling, and coordinating care as needed.

Schedule Flexibility: This position offers flexible scheduling, including the possibility to adjust shifts throughout the week. Saturdays are included, with pay differentials for weekend hours.

This role provides the opportunity to work with a diverse patient population, including individuals from both typical and underserved communities. You will play a key role in improving patient outcomes, mentoring graduate students, and contributing to the development of innovative care strategies.

Core Responsibilities:

  1. Patient Care: Conduct comprehensive, evidence-based evaluations and provide personalized treatment to patients with neurological conditions, addressing communication, cognitive, and swallowing needs.
  2. Assessment & Testing: Perform thorough assessments to determine appropriate therapy goals and interventions, ensuring optimal patient progress and outcomes.
  3. Mentorship & Education: Mentor graduate Speech Therapy students and clinical fellows, sharing expertise and contributing to the development of best practices in neurorehabilitation.
  4. Interdisciplinary Collaboration: Work closely with the interdisciplinary team to develop and implement patient care plans, adjusting strategies based on patient progress and feedback.
  5. Community Engagement: Participate in clinic outreach initiatives, such as food banks and health programs, to assist underserved populations in accessing care and improving wellness.
  6. Quality Improvement: Maintain detailed patient records, contributing to ongoing efforts to improve care delivery and patient outcomes in the clinic.

Education Requirements:
● Graduation from an accredited Speech-Language Pathology program.
Licensure/Certification Requirements:
● Speech-Language Pathology certification by the American Speech-Language-Hearing Association (ASHA).Licensed as a Speech-Language Pathologist by the North Carolina Board of Examiners for Speech-Language Pathologists and Audiologists.
Professional Experience Requirements:
● One (1) year of experience in the field of Speech Pathology.
